openLayers完整代码示例数据
![preview](https://csdnimg.cn/release/downloadcmsfe/public/img/white-bg.ca8570fa.png)
![preview-icon](https://csdnimg.cn/release/downloadcmsfe/public/img/scale.ab9e0183.png)
OpenLayers 是一个开源JavaScript库,专门用于在网页上创建交互式的地图应用。它支持多种地图服务,包括WMS、WMTS、TMS等,并且兼容各种浏览器,包括桌面端和移动设备。这个压缩包文件包含了一系列JSON数据,很可能是用于OpenLayers中展示地理信息的配置或样例数据。 我们来看一下这些文件的命名: - lishicaoqu.json:可能代表历史草区的数据,可能包含了地理坐标和相关属性信息。 - wenhuaxianlutang.json:可能是文化线路塘的数据,可能记录了文化线路中的特定地点或区域。 - wenhuaxianluqing.json:可能代表文化线路情,可能包含线路的描述、状态或其他相关信息。 - wenhuaxianluming.json:可能是文化线路鸣的数据,可能涉及到声音或文化活动相关的信息。 - wenhuaxianluxihan.json:可能表示文化线路咸寒,可能与气候或季节性特征相关。 - wenhuaxianluqin.json:可能是文化线路琴的数据,可能与音乐或艺术表演场所有关。 在OpenLayers中,这些JSON文件通常用来存储地图的图层信息,如几何对象(点、线、面)、属性数据、样式规则等。例如,它们可以定义如下内容: 1. **几何对象**:每个JSON对象可能包含多个几何对象,如GeoJSON格式,表示地图上的点、线或多边形。点代表单个位置,线表示路径或边界,多边形则用于填充区域。 2. **属性数据**:除了几何信息,每个对象还可能携带相关的属性数据,比如地点名称、时间戳、描述等,这些数据可以用于信息提示或者过滤操作。 3. **样式规则**:JSON文件还可以定义图层的样式,比如颜色、线宽、填充图案等。OpenLayers允许用户自定义图层的视觉表现,根据属性值来动态改变样式。 4. **图层加载**:在OpenLayers应用中,这些JSON数据可以通过`ol.source.Vector`和`ol.layer.Vector`进行加载和展示。通过读取JSON文件并创建相应的Source,然后将Source添加到地图的图层中。 5. **交互功能**:OpenLayers支持丰富的交互功能,如点击获取信息、拖动缩放、测量距离等,这些功能可以与JSON数据结合,提供丰富的地图交互体验。 6. **动态更新**:如果JSON数据能实时更新,OpenLayers也可以实现动态显示地图变化,如监控交通流量、天气情况等。 这个压缩包提供的OpenLayers示例数据涵盖了多个文化线路相关的地理信息,通过OpenLayers库,我们可以将这些数据转化为交互式地图,展示在网页上,帮助用户更好地理解和探索这些文化线路。这不仅有助于学术研究,也能为旅游、教育等领域提供直观的信息展示工具。在实际应用中,开发人员需要结合JSON数据的结构和OpenLayers API,编写JavaScript代码来构建地图应用,实现数据的动态加载、渲染以及与用户的交互。
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![zip](https://img-home.csdnimg.cn/images/20210720083646.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![zip](https://img-home.csdnimg.cn/images/20210720083646.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![jsp](https://img-home.csdnimg.cn/images/20210720083646.png)
![rar](https://img-home.csdnimg.cn/images/20210720083606.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![rar](https://img-home.csdnimg.cn/images/20210720083606.png)
![package](https://csdnimg.cn/release/downloadcmsfe/public/img/package.f3fc750b.png)
![file-type](https://csdnimg.cn/release/download/static_files/pc/images/minetype/UNKNOWN.png)
![file-type](https://csdnimg.cn/release/download/static_files/pc/images/minetype/UNKNOWN.png)
![file-type](https://csdnimg.cn/release/download/static_files/pc/images/minetype/UNKNOWN.png)
![file-type](https://csdnimg.cn/release/download/static_files/pc/images/minetype/UNKNOWN.png)
![file-type](https://csdnimg.cn/release/download/static_files/pc/images/minetype/UNKNOWN.png)
![file-type](https://csdnimg.cn/release/download/static_files/pc/images/minetype/UNKNOWN.png)
- 1
![avatar-default](https://csdnimg.cn/release/downloadcmsfe/public/img/lazyLogo2.1882d7f4.png)
![avatar](https://profile-avatar.csdnimg.cn/0e96c2167332472c86ee95560db5a42a_weixin_46029283.jpg!1)
- 粉丝: 43
- 资源: 5
我的内容管理 展开
我的资源 快来上传第一个资源
我的收益
登录查看自己的收益我的积分 登录查看自己的积分
我的C币 登录后查看C币余额
我的收藏
我的下载
下载帮助
![voice](https://csdnimg.cn/release/downloadcmsfe/public/img/voice.245cc511.png)
![center-task](https://csdnimg.cn/release/downloadcmsfe/public/img/center-task.c2eda91a.png)
最新资源
- 打包和分发Rust工具.pdf
- SQL中的CREATE LOGFILE GROUP 语句.pdf
- C语言-leetcode题解之第172题阶乘后的零.zip
- C语言-leetcode题解之第171题Excel列表序号.zip
- C语言-leetcode题解之第169题多数元素.zip
- ocr-图像识别资源ocr-图像识别资源
- 图像识别:基于Resnet50 + VGG16模型融合的人体细胞癌症分类模型实现-图像识别资源
- C语言-leetcode题解之第168题Excel列表名称.zip
- C语言-leetcode题解之第167题两数之和II-输入有序数组.zip
- C语言-leetcode题解之第166题分数到小数.zip
![feedback](https://img-home.csdnimg.cn/images/20220527035711.png)
![feedback-tip](https://img-home.csdnimg.cn/images/20220527035111.png)
![dialog-icon](https://csdnimg.cn/release/downloadcmsfe/public/img/green-success.6a4acb44.png)